ISIL poses unprecedented threat to US - Hagel

WASHINGTON, Aug 21 (KUNA) -- Secretary of Defense Chuck Hagel on Thursday warned that the Islamic State of Iraq and the Levant (ISIL or ISIS) poses "a long term threat," beyond anything the US has seen.
"They're (ISIL) beyond just a terrorist group. They marry ideology, a sophistication of strategic and tactical military prowess. They are tremendously well-funded," he told the press alongside General Dempsey, Chairman of the Joints Chief of Staff.
Answering a question on the failed attempt to rescue American hostages, held by the group in Syria, Hagel said: "This operation, by the way, was a flawless operation. But the hostages were not there. So we'll do everything that we need to do -- to get our hostages back." In terms of combating ISIL Dempsey said: "It is possible to contain them, and I think we've seen that their momentum was disrupted -- Can they be defeated without addressing that part of their organization which resides in Syria, the answer is no." "ISIS will only truly be defeated when it's rejected by the 20 million disenfranchised Sunnis that happen to reside between Damascus and Baghdad," asserted Dempsey.
Hagel reiterated, "So we must prepare for everything, and the only way you do you take a cold, steely hard look at it and get ready." (end) ak.gb
